An aluminum tube is a cylindrical piece of aluminum known for its light weight, high strength, and corrosion resistance. These tubes are widely used across industries, including construction, automotive, aerospace, and manufacturing, due to their versatility and durability. They can be extruded in different shapes, such as round, square, or rectangular, and come in various sizes and thicknesses to suit different applications.

PROPERTIES OF ALUMINUM TUBES

Lightweight: Aluminum is much lighter than steel or other metals, making it easier to handle and transport.

Corrosion Resistant: It has a natural oxide layer that protects it from corrosion, which makes it suitable for outdoor or marine applications.

High Strength-to-Weight Ratio: Despite its lightweight nature, aluminum offers excellent strength, especially when alloyed with other elements.

Conductivity: Aluminum is a good conductor of electricity and heat, which makes it useful in electrical and thermal applications.

Malleable: It can be easily shaped and extruded into various forms, including tubes with round, square, or custom profiles.

TYPES OF ALUMINUM TUBES

SEAMLESS ALUMINUM TUBES
Made without any welded seams, providing a smooth surface and better resistance to pressure.

WELDED ALUMINUM TUBES
Made by welding a rolled aluminum sheet into a tube, which can be more cost-effective but may have slightly lower pressure resistance.

 

COMMON USES OF ALUMINUM TUBES

Construction: Used in frameworks, scaffolding, railings, and roofing structures due to its strength and resistance to corrosion.

Automotive and Aerospace: Helps reduce vehicle and aircraft weight, improving fuel efficiency and performance.

Manufacturing: Used in making various products, from furniture to medical equipment, due to its versatility and ease of fabrication.

Heat Exchangers and Cooling Systems: Utilized in radiators, condensers, and HVAC systems because of their high thermal conductivity.
